I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Hibernate Java Discussion :

Recuperation de resultat de requette SQL


Sujet :

Hibernate Java

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Inscrit en
    Décembre 2009
    Messages
    19
    Détails du profil
    Informations forums :
    Inscription : Décembre 2009
    Messages : 19
    Par défaut Recuperation de resultat de requette SQL
    Salut tout le monde, j'ai une requete avec jointure que j'envoie pour avoir une liste de comptes.
    j'ai le code suivant :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
     
    public List afficherComptes(String account,String charge,String type,String city,String secteur)
    	throws Exception {
     
    String req = null;
    Session session = HibernateUtil.currentSession();
    Query q= session.createSQLQuery("select a.name,u.user_name,a.billing_address_city,a.phone_office,a.industry,c.description,MAX(c.date_start) from accounts a,users u,calls c where a.name like '%"+account+"%' and u.id='"+charge+"' and a.assigned_user_id=u.id and c.parent_id=a.id group by a.name order by a.name ASC");
     
    listecomptes = q.list();
    return listecomptes;
    }
    Avec listecomptes de type <Comptes>.
    Ma fonction m'envoie une liste d'objet :
    [Ljava.lang.Object;@4d28c7
    [Ljava.lang.Object;@accd65
    [Ljava.lang.Object;@e0d156
    [Ljava.lang.Object;@1d8f69
    [Ljava.lang.Object;@ez87f5
    ....
    Pouvez vous m'aider à récuperer le résultat de ma requete je ne sais pas comment transformer cette liste d'objet en colonnes renvoyer par ma requete.

  2. #2
    Modérateur
    Avatar de dinobogan
    Homme Profil pro
    ingénieur
    Inscrit en
    Juin 2007
    Messages
    4 073
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44
    Localisation : France

    Informations professionnelles :
    Activité : ingénieur
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juin 2007
    Messages : 4 073
    Par défaut
    La méthode par défaut toString de Comptes est utilisée pour l'affichage. Si elle n'est pas redéfinie, c'est le pointeur qui est affiché.
    soit tu définis une méthode toString dans Comptes, soit tu modifies ta technique d'affichage pour aller chercher correctement les bons objets dans chaque objet Comptes.
    N'oubliez pas de consulter les FAQ Java et les cours et tutoriels Java
    Que la force de la puissance soit avec le courage de ta sagesse.

Discussions similaires

  1. l'affectation du resultat d'une requette sql a une variable vb
    Par milanino dans le forum Windows Forms
    Réponses: 2
    Dernier message: 16/05/2009, 13h00
  2. recuperer le resultat d"une requete sql
    Par xanthie dans le forum Débuter
    Réponses: 2
    Dernier message: 19/03/2008, 17h40
  3. Comment recuperer le resultat de l'execution d'une chaine sql
    Par davidou2001 dans le forum MS SQL Server
    Réponses: 7
    Dernier message: 12/06/2007, 13h29
  4. [c#][sql server ce] recuperer le resultat dune requete sql
    Par Jessika dans le forum Windows Mobile
    Réponses: 1
    Dernier message: 09/05/2007, 10h08
  5. [c#]Recuperer le resultat d'une requette SELECT @@IDENTITY
    Par MaxiMax dans le forum Windows Forms
    Réponses: 8
    Dernier message: 01/07/2005, 17h12

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o